About the community
Bonaventure of Puyallup is a senior living community offering independent living, assisted living, and memory care services in the beautiful city of Puyallup, Washington. Situated next to the local park and community center, residents can easily partake in community events. The area also provides easy access to grocery stores, restaurants, banks, and retail stores. Best of all, the community itself offers senior-friendly apartments, state-of-the-art amenities, and a schedule of fun activities. This newly constructed, multistory community features warm colors and stone elements that give the exterior a modern feel while the interior is adorned with cozy furnishings that help residents feel at home. Residents are free to choose how they spend their time — they can take advantage of the on-site pub, cafe, fitness center, garden and hobby center, library, game room, and lounges. Residents can also join one another for regularly scheduled activities that keep them socially, cognitively, and physically engaged. Activities include holiday parties, educational classes, religious services, and more. At Bonaventure of Puyallup, residents' health and wellness come first. That is precisely why a highly competent team of professionals comes together to offer assistance with daily living activities, companionship, and personalized care and support. Additionally, residents are sure to find a suitable home when selecting from stunning floor plans that include options for studio, one-bedroom, two-bedroom, and cottage-style apartments. State Classification Bonaventure of Puyallup is an assisted living facility , which in the state of Washington includes a private apartment, some type of nursing care provided occasionally, and available help for medication administration and personal care.
